Postby ChuckS on Sun Jun 01, 2008 6:59 pm

As of our last experience, factory tours needed to be scheduled, and were booked several months in advance.
However, the museum is great and there are Porsches everywhere, including the largest dealership I have ever seen that is about 1/2 mile from the museum.

Best of Luck in getting in. I am told it is fantastic. :D
